§ 77-5016.01 — Oath, affirmation, or statement; perjury

Text

Each appeal or petition filed with the commission shall be deemed to include an oath, affirmation, or statement to the effect that its representations are true as far as the person executing or filing it knows or should know. Any person who willfully falsifies any such representation shall be guilty of perjury and shall, upon conviction thereof, be punished as provided by section 28-915 .

Legislative History

Source: Laws 2004, LB 973, § 52.
